Table of Contents

Class SettingsGroupRegistration

Namespace
SharpConsoleUI.Core
Assembly
SharpConsoleUI.dll

Registration for a settings group containing one or more pages.

public record SettingsGroupRegistration : IEquatable<SettingsGroupRegistration>
Inheritance
SettingsGroupRegistration
Implements
Inherited Members
Extension Methods

Constructors

SettingsGroupRegistration(string, Color, List<SettingsPageRegistration>)

Registration for a settings group containing one or more pages.

public SettingsGroupRegistration(string Name, Color AccentColor, List<SettingsPageRegistration> Pages)

Parameters

Name string
AccentColor Color
Pages List<SettingsPageRegistration>

Properties

AccentColor

public Color AccentColor { get; init; }

Property Value

Color

Name

public string Name { get; init; }

Property Value

string

Pages

public List<SettingsPageRegistration> Pages { get; init; }

Property Value

List<SettingsPageRegistration>